van der SLUIS, Melis:
Died peacefully in his sleep on 3rd February 2023; in his 92nd year. Much loved husband of Ruth; Father and father-in-law of Eric & Joanna, and Karen; Opa of Josh, Sarah, Thomas, Max, Lola, and Coco. A Memorial Service for Melis will be held in the Woodside Estate, 132 Woodside Road, Tamahere, Hamilton, on Wednesday, 8th February 2023 at 2.00pm.
